61 35 085 Removing and installing/replacing control unit/module for left or right seat adjustment (rear Comfort seat)

IMPORTANT: Read and comply with notes on protection against electrostatic damage (ESD PROTECTION) .

Necessary preliminary tasks: 

NOTE: For purposes of clarity, the following operations are shown in the released state.

Detach cover (1) from Velcro fastener.

Pull cover (1) upwards out of guide from four-bar lever.

NOTE: For purposes of clarity, graphic shows backrest removed:
Unlock and disconnect all plug connections in marked area.

Installation note: 

Plug connections are coded against incorrect assembly.

Press control unit against spring and remove towards top.

NOTE: If the rear Comfort seat is defective:
Partially remove the backrest for the seat on the left or right.

Necessary preliminary tasks: 

Remove LEFT OR RIGHT REAR SEAT

Release screw (1).

Installation note: 

Replace screw (1).

Tightening torque 52 25 05AZ .

Unscrew nuts (1).

Carefully raise the seat frame (2) in the direction of arrow.

Installation note: 

Replace nuts (1).

Tightening torque 52 25 05AZ .

Unlock plug connections (1) and disconnect.

Press control unit against spring and feed out.

Installation note: 

Make sure mounting (1) and retaining tabs (2) of control unit (3) are correctly seated.

Replacement: 

Carry out vehicle PROGRAMMING/ENCODING .
